This week Seagate announced its new Creative Professionals Program (CPP), an initiative designed to drive greater awareness of how important digital storage is for the creative workflow for music, film and photography professionals. Initial program participants include Grammy award-winning keyboardist Rami Jaffee (The Wallflowers, The Foo Fighters), National Geographic photographer and NPPA Magazine Photographer of the Year Jim Sugar, Producer and audio engineer Andrew “Mudrock” Murdock (Godsmack, Avenged Sevenfold, Riverboat Gamblers), Professional photographer Gary Copeland (Client roster includes: Volcom, Converse, Arnetter, Oakley, Epitaph Records), and DJ Jam (Official DJ for Dr. Dre and Snoop Dogg).
